Rebound is hiring for a full-time Controller to oversee the organization's daily accounting, banking, audit, AP, and tax functions. This includes maintaining compliance with internal financial reporting standards, production of periodic financial reports, and a comprehensive set of controls and budgets designed to mitigate risk. Produce regular monthly, quarterly, and annual reports that provide insight into the business performance. **Responsibilities:** - Support an environment that reinforces Rebound’s mission and Core Values of **Superior Service, Teamwork, Integrity, Innovation, Quality** and **Recognition.** - **Financial Services – Manage Financial Accounting, Tax Reporting, AP, and Banking** - Manage monthly close process and preparation of financial reports as required. - Maintain loans and debt management schedules. - Manage Year-end tax planning and analysis. - Administer the 401(k) and profit-sharing plan, including compliance and reporting. Lead the retirement committee. - Manage all accounting, payroll and purchasing systems. - Monitor compliance with laws and regulations and assure required legal and regulatory documents are filed and. Oversee timely reporting as required by federal, state, and local regulatory agencies. - Build and manage relationships with external partners, including, but not limited to, financial institutions, CPA’s and independent auditors. - Financial oversight and management of the Rebound Research & Education Foundation and Surgical Specialists Investment, LLC. - **Provide leadership and supervise the accounting team** - Provide leadership to ensure consistent, high-quality service across the organization. - Recruit, hire, onboard and supervise accounting staff. - Direct and oversee the daily operations of the accounting team to optimize department function and maximize productivity. - Provide ongoing training and development. Establish performance standards, conduct evaluations, coaching and development plans to drive individual and team success. - **Financial Planning, Reporting & Analysis** - Lead monthly financial reporting, forecasting, and variance analysis. - Prepare and manage the annual budgeting process. - Develop forward-looking financial models and performance projections. - Deliver insights on income, expenses, and earnings based on current and expected operations. - Publish quarterly “silo” reports assessing profitability by specialty for both Rebound and ASC. - Monitor key financial and operational KPIs. - **Provide analysis and financial optimization on areas such as:** - Supply cost management. - Operational productivity and performance standards. - Profitability drivers. - Support benchmarking against industry standards. - Contract negotiations. - Feasibility studies and growth initiatives. - Respond to ad hoc analysis needs from leadership. **Qualifications:** - Degree in business administration, accounting or finance or an equivalent combination of education, certification, training and/or experience. - Ten years of experience in financial/accounting management. Three years of experience as a senior executive. Experience in health care financial management strongly preferred. - Superior knowledge of the principles of financial management sufficient to direct professional staff and coordinate all aspects involved with fiscal requirements. - Highly proficient in Excel and financial programs. - Knowledge of clinical financial and budgetary practices to develop annual budget, analyze financial data and patterns, and prepare financial statements. - Ability to understand and comply with governmental and health care fiscal regulations and reporting requirements. - Skill in exercising a high degree of initiative, judgment, discretion, and decision making to achieve objectives. - Skill in evaluating operations as they relate to policies, goals, objectives and costs. - Effective oral and written communication skills.
